What to Expect
Office and administration roles typically involve tasks like managing emails, planning schedules, filing documents, and supporting teams with various organizational activities. Working hours are usually standard, such as Monday to Friday, with a typical workweek of 37.5 to 40 hours. The working environment is mostly indoors, in modern offices, which are well-equipped. The physical demands are generally low but may include long periods at a desk. During peak times, such as for quarterly reports or annual audits, extra hours or shifts might be required. It's common to work with computers, phones, and office software like Microsoft Office or Dutch-specific tools. Employers in Goirle and nearby areas are often flexible, offering options for full-time or part-time roles, including seasonal or temporary positions.
Requirements
To work in office and administration roles in the Netherlands, you should have good organizational skills and basic proficiency in English or Dutch. Most roles do not require extensive experience but prefer candidates with prior administrative or customer service experience. A valid BSN (Dutch citizen service number) is necessary for legal employment, along with a bank account in the Netherlands. Some positions might require a basic knowledge of office software or the ability to communicate clearly. Documents like a valid ID, proof of residence, and work permits (if applicable) will be needed to complete the registration process. Some employers may also value language skills in other EU languages, especially in customer service roles.
Salary & Benefits
In 2026, the minimum wage in the Netherlands for workers aged 21 and above is €14.71 per hour. In office and administration jobs, salaries typically start around €15 to €20 per hour, depending on experience and specific roles. Many employers also offer benefits such as holiday pay, paid time off, and sometimes health insurance contributions. Some companies might provide additional perks like travel allowances or flexible schedules. Working in the Netherlands ensures access to statutory rights under the collective labor agreement (CAO), offering protections and fair working conditions.
